That Gwen Stefani question was an epic fail...and it only occurred in the round where you're deeply penalized for missing a question. So no big deal :lol: :roll:

This current Playback writer that's been there for the last year or two seems to have a strong love of 2000s R&B. I guess the question writer was trying to say in what year did Gwen have her first chart hit outside of No Doubt? But it was a poorly worded question since her real solo career began in 2004. The writer loves R&B, she remembered the Eve / Gwen duet from 2001, and that's how she arrived at the answer of 2001 for that question.

Except that's still not right. The writer seemingly forgot about the duet that Gwen had with Moby the year before that. So the "correct" answer is actually 2000.

What the writer should've done was just ask for the song title or the name of the duet partner that Gwen teamed up with in 2001.
